NetWorker: nsraddadmin returns "Bad resource file." error

Summary: NetWorker nsraddadmin command returns "Bad resource file."

This article applies to This article does not apply to This article is not tied to any specific product. Not all product versions are identified in this article.

Symptoms

  • The following error appears when trying to browse save set
user root does not have the privileges required to start the requested job. The required privilege is Operator NetWorker
  • nsraddadmin returns a "Bad resource file" when adding an entry to the external roles field.

Cause

The local user's Distinguished Name (DN) is missing from the Application Administrator Usergroup's external roles field.

Resolution

  1. Open an elevated prompt on the NetWorker server.
  2. Add the NetWorker server's local authentication service to the Administrators list: nsraddadmin -H NETWORKER_SERVER_NAME -P 9090
  3. If the NMC uses a separate authentication host from the NetWorker server, run: nsraddadmin -H REMOTE_AUTHC_SERVER_NAME -P 9090
    To identify which host the NMC uses for authentication, see: NetWorker: How To Identify Which Server is the Authentication Server Used By NMC and NWUI

Example Output:

PS C:\Users\Administrator.NETWORKER> nsraddadmin -H nve.networker.lan -P 9090
134751:nsraddadmin: Added role 'cn=Administrators,cn=Groups,dc=nve,dc=networker,dc=lan' to the 'Security Administrators' user group.
134751:nsraddadmin: Added role 'cn=Administrators,cn=Groups,dc=nve,dc=networker,dc=lan' to the 'Application Administrators' user group.
134751:nsraddadmin: Added role 'cn=Users,cn=Groups,dc=nve,dc=networker,dc=lan' to the 'Users' user group.
